Artistic Expression in MLB
Fans express frustration over the lack of artistic expression in MLB, particularly on catchers’ masks. Many believe that allowing designs would not only enhance the visual appeal of the game but also provide players with a way to showcase their personality on the field.
Regulations and Creativity
Some users speculate that the ban on designs could be related to sponsor ad placement opportunities. The high cost of such placements may be deterring MLB from allowing players to customize their gear. However, fans argue that artistic expression should not be limited by financial considerations.
Nostalgia and Individuality
References to iconic designs, such as the ‘Nats mask,’ highlight the nostalgia associated with personalized gear. Fans recall instances of creativity in sports equipment, like a catcher wearing a football visor, and emphasize the importance of individuality and self-expression in professional sports.
